
/* navigation links */
A:link {
	color: #525252;
	text-decoration: none;
}

A:active  {
	color: #0d701e;
	text-decoration: none;
}

A:hover  {
	color: #0d701e;
	text-decoration: none;
}

A:visited {
	color: #525252;
	text-decoration: none;
}

A:visited:hover {
	color: #0d701e;
	text-decoration: none;
}




.right  {
	text-align:right;
	}

/* copy */

.font25b { 
	font-size: 25px;
	font-family: Arial, Helvetica, sans-serif;
	color: #525252;
	font-weight: bold;
}
.font17b { 
	font-size: 17px;
	font-family: Arial, Helvetica, sans-serif;
	color: #383838;
	font-weight: bold;
}
.font17bLight { 
	font-size: 17px;
	font-family: Arial, Helvetica, sans-serif;
	color: #9F9F9F;
	font-weight: bold;
}
.font22b { 
	font-size: 22px;
	font-family: Arial, Helvetica, sans-serif;
	color: #383838;
	font-weight: bold;
}
.font14b { 
	font-size: 14px;
	font-family: Arial, Helvetica, sans-serif;
	color: #525252;
	font-weight: bold;
}
.font14bpurple { 
	font-size: 14px;
	font-family: Arial, Helvetica, sans-serif;
	color: #994aa3;
	font-weight: bold;
	
}.font11bpurple { 
	font-size: 11px;
	font-family: Arial, Helvetica, sans-serif;
	color: #994aa3;
	font-weight: bold;
}

.font13 { 
	font-size: 13px;
	font-family: Arial, Helvetica, sans-serif;
	color: #525252;
	font-weight: normal;
}
.font13b { 
	font-size: 13px;
	font-family: Arial, Helvetica, sans-serif;
	color: #525252;
	font-weight: bold;
}

.font12 { 
	font-size: 12px;
	font-family: Arial, Helvetica, sans-serif;
	color: #525252;
}

.font12purple { 
	font-size: 13px;
	font-family: Arial, Helvetica, sans-serif;
	font-weight: bold;
	color: #6d168b;
}

.font12form { 
	font-size: 12px;
	font-family: Arial, Helvetica, sans-serif;
	color: #525252;
	padding-bottom: 5px;
}

.font11 { 
	font-size: 11px;
	font-family: Arial, Helvetica, sans-serif;
	color: #525252;
}
.font11b { 
	font-size: 11px;
	font-family: Arial, Helvetica, sans-serif;
	color: #525252;
	font-weight: bold;
}
.font10 { 
	font-size: 10px;
	font-family: Arial, Helvetica, sans-serif;
	color: #525252;
}
.font13whitebold { 
	font-size: 13px;
	font-family: Arial, Helvetica, sans-serif;
	color: #ffffff;
	font-weight: bold;
}

.footer { 
	font-size: 11px;
	font-family: Arial, Helvetica, sans-serif;
	color: #6d6d6d;
}

.chartfont12grayb { 
	font-size: 12px;
	font-family: Arial, Helvetica, sans-serif;
	color: #525252;
	font-weight: bold;
	padding-left: 2px;
	padding-top: 5px;
	padding-right: 2px;
	padding-bottom: 4px;
}
.chartfont12grayc { 
	font-size: 12px;
	font-family: Arial, Helvetica, sans-serif;
	color: #525252;
	/*padding-left: 2px;*/
	padding-right: 2px;
	padding-top: 5px;
	padding-bottom: 5px;
}
.chartfont12gray { 
	font-size: 12px;
	font-family: Arial, Helvetica, sans-serif;
	color: #525252;
	padding-left: 11px;
	padding-top: 11px;
	padding-bottom: 11px;
}


.font16redbold { 
	font-size: 16px;
	font-family: Arial, Helvetica, sans-serif;
	color: #da050a;
	font-weight: bold;
}

.font11white { 
	font-size: 11px;
	font-family: Arial, Helvetica, sans-serif;
	color: #ffffff;
}

.font12white { 
	font-size: 12px;
	font-family: Arial, Helvetica, sans-serif;
	color: #ffffff;
}



.categoryblue { 
	font-size: 12px;
	font-family: Arial, Helvetica, sans-serif;
	color: #3361c7;
	padding-left: 10px

}
.right {
	text-align: right
}

/* forms */


.frmlabel { 
	font-size: 13px;
	font-family: Arial, Helvetica, sans-serif;
	color: #525252;
	font-weight: bold;
	padding-right: 10px
}
.frmInput  {
	width:225px;
	height:20px;
	border: solid 1px #dddcd7;
	background:#f5f4f0;
	font-size:12px;
	font-family: Arial, Helvetica, san-serif;
	font-weight: normal;
	color: #525252;
	padding: 2px;
}

.formdropdown  {
	width:225px;
	height:20px;
	border: solid 1px #dddcd7;
	background: #f5f4f0;
	font-size:12px;
	font-family: Arial, Helvetica, san-serif;
	font-weight: normal;
	color: #525252;
	padding: 2px;

}

.formdropdownnav  {
	width:161px;
	height:20px;
	border: solid 1px #dddcd7;
	background:#f5f4f0;
	font-size:12px;
	font-family: Arial, Helvetica, san-serif;
	font-weight: normal;
	color: #525252;
	padding: 2px;
}
.formmultiselect  {
	width:161px;
	height:100px;
	border: solid 1px #dddcd7;
	background:#f5f4f0;
	font-size:12px;
	font-family: Arial, Helvetica, san-serif;
	font-weight: normal;
	color: #525252;
}
.formmultiselectlong  {
	width:171px;
	height:100px;
	border: solid 1px #dddcd7;
	background:#f5f4f0;
	font-size:12px;
	font-family: Arial, Helvetica, san-serif;
	font-weight: normal;
	color: #525252;
}
.formdropdownnavsmall  {
	width:54px;
	/*height:20px;
	border: solid 1px #dddcd7;*/
	background:#f5f4f0;
	font-size:12px;
	font-family: Arial, Helvetica, san-serif;
	font-weight: normal;
	color: #525252;
	
}
.formdropdowndate  {
	width:115px;
	height:20px;
	border: solid 1px #dddcd7;
	background:#f5f4f0;
	font-size:10px;
	font-family: Arial, Helvetica, san-serif;
	font-weight: normal;
	color: #525252;
	padding: 2px;
}

.formdropdownstate  {
	width:50px;
	height:20px;
	border: solid 1px #f5f4f0;
	background: #f5f4f0;
	font-size:12px;
	font-family: Arial, Helvetica, san-serif;
	font-weight: normal;
	color: #525252;
	padding: 2px;

}
.frmmonth  {
	width:50px;
	/*height:25px;*/
	border: solid 1px #dddcd7;
	background:#f5f4f0;
	font-size:12px;
	font-family: Arial, Helvetica, san-serif;
	font-weight: normal;
	color: #525252;
	padding: 2px;
}

.frmday  {
	width:50px;
	/*height:25px;*/
	border: solid 1px #dddcd7;
	background:#f5f4f0;
	font-size:12px;
	font-family: Arial, Helvetica, san-serif;
	font-weight: normal;
	color: #525252;
	padding: 2px;
}

.frmyear  {
	width:60px;
	/*height:25px;*/
	border: solid 1px #f5f4f0;
	background:#f5f4f0;
	font-size:12px;
	font-family: Arial, Helvetica, san-serif;
	font-weight: normal;
	color: #525252;
	padding: 2px;
}

.frmbox  {
	width:17px;
	height:21px;
	border: solid 1px #b1b1b1;
	background:#ffffff;
	font-size:10px;
	font-family: Arial, Helvetica, san-serif;
	font-weight: normal;
	color: #666666;
}





.button { 
 font: 12px Arial, Helvetica, sans-serif; 
 background-color: #ba6acb; 
 color: #ffffff; 
 margin-left: 12px; 
 margin-top: 3px; 
 margin-bottom: 2px; 
 width:80px;
height:23px;
border-top: solid 1px #d6a4e1;
border-left: solid 1px #d6a4e1;
border-bottom: solid 1px #792595;
border-right: solid 1px #792595;
}

.nav button { 
 font: 12px Arial, Helvetica, sans-serif; 
 background-color: #ba6acb; 
 color: #ffffff; 
 margin-left: 12px; 
 margin-top: 3px; 
 margin-bottom: 2px; 
 width:80px;
height:23px;
border-top: solid 1px #d6a4e1;
border-left: solid 1px #d6a4e1;
border-bottom: solid 1px #792595;
border-right: solid 1px #792595;
	}
.label
{
width: 109px;
float: left;
text-align: right;
margin-right: 7px;
display: block;
font-size:11px;
font-family: Arial, Helvetica, san-serif;
color: #666666;
}
.alignmiddle {
	vertical-align:middle;
	text-align:center;
	}


.fltleft {
	float:left;
	margin-right:10px;
	}
#media_press {
	margin-left:25px;
	margin-right:25px;
	vertical-align:top;
	text-align:left;
	font-family:Arial, Helvetica, sans-serif;
	font-size:12px;
	}
#about li {
	list-style:square;
	color:#994aa3;
	list-style-position:outside;

	}

#media_press li {
	list-style:square;
	color:#994aa3;
	list-style-position:outside;
	margin-bottom:15px;
	}
#directors {
	margin-left:25px;
	margin-right:25px;
	vertical-align:top;
	text-align:left;
	font-family:Arial, Helvetica, sans-serif;
	font-size:11px;
	}
#directors li {
	list-style:square;
	list-style-position:outside;
	margin-bottom:15px;
	}
#directors a:link{
	color:#169e2e;
	font-family:Arial, Helvetica, sans-serif;
	font-size:13px;
	font-weight:bold;
	text-decoration:none;
	}
#directors a:visited{
	color:#169e2e;
	font-family:Arial, Helvetica, sans-serif;
	font-size:13px;
	font-weight:bold;
	text-decoration:none;
	}
#directors a:hover{
	color:#994aa3;
	font-family:Arial, Helvetica, sans-serif;
	font-size:13px;
	font-weight:bold;
	text-decoration:none;
	}
#directors a:active{
	color:#169e2e;
	font-family:Arial, Helvetica, sans-serif;
	font-size:13px;
	font-weight:bold;
	text-decoration:none;
	}
#whyworkatreply {
	font-family:Arial, Helvetica, sans-serif;
	font-size:12px;
	width:100%;
	text-align:left;
	padding:5px;
	}
#contactbox {
	font-family:Arial, Helvetica, sans-serif;
	font-size:12px;
	width:600px;
	text-align:left;
	padding:5px;
	}
.purplesubhead2
{
    FONT-WEIGHT: bold;
    FONT-SIZE: 14px;
    COLOR: #660066;
    FONT-FAMILY: Arial, Helvetica, sans-serif
}
.copybold
{
    FONT-WEIGHT: bold;
    FONT-SIZE: 12px;
    COLOR: #000000;
    FONT-FAMILY: Arial, Helvetica, sans-serif
}
